In Hazira,SuratGujara industrial zone there are industries like ONGC,KRIBHCO,NTPC,SHELL,RELIANCE,ESSAR,L&T,GSPC,GIPCL,GAIL,IOC STORAGES etc .Listed petrochemical companies handling and transporting Explosive, Flammable, Toxic, Carceogenic liquids and gases using tankers and truck trollies and by railway,Almost 10000 vehicles moving everyday across this zone including employees,local residencial and transport carriers.most worst road condition and heavy traffic nuissons in this zone,

While innovative ideas like fuel cell, hybrid engines and others take time to materialise, an immediate step would be to popularise public transport. It should be made attractive, efficient, safe and a viable alternative to individual cars and bikes. It will cut down the requirement on fuel, road and parking space, as well as cut down pollution Cutting down on free access to parking areas and road space may also act as a deterrent to private conveyance and encourage public transport,
